허용적 라이선스와 카피레프트 라이선스 비교
I. 개념비교
| 항목 | 허용적 라이선스 | 카피레프트 라이선스 |
|---|---|---|
| 개념 | 사용·수정·재배포 자유, 동일조건 의무 없음 | 사용·수정·재배포 자유, 파생물 동일조건 의무 |
| 특징① | 상용 소스 결합 용이 | 수정 시 동일 라이선스 강제 |
| 특징② | 제약 최소·실용성 | 자유 공유 확산 |
요약: 허용적=자유 활용 중심, 카피레프트=자유 공유 확산 중심.
II. 상세비교
가. 개념도 비교
허용적 ──▶ 자유 활용(제약 최소) 예: BSD, MIT, Apache 카피레프트 ──▶ 자유 보장 + 동일조건 의무 예: GPL, AGPL, LGPL
요약: 허용적은 실사용 유연성, 카피레프트는 공유 의무를 통한 자유 확산.
나. 상세비교 표
| 구분 | 허용적 | 카피레프트 |
|---|---|---|
| 대표유형 | BSD, MIT, Apache-2.0 | GPLv3, AGPLv3, LGPLv3 |
| 핵심 의무 | 출처 표기, 면책·저작권 고지 | 출처 + 동일라이선스 적용(전염성) |
| 상용 결합 | 가능(비공개 배포 허용) | 제약(소스 공개 요구 가능) |
| 배포 모델 | SaaS/상용 제품에 우호적 | 커뮤니티 확산·기여 유도 |
| 철학 | 사용자 자유·실용 극대화 | 공유를 통한 자유 보장 |
| 사례 | 클라우드 SDK, 상용 내장 | 리눅스 커널, 서버SW |
결론: 기업 상용화는 허용적이 적합, 공공 기여 확대는 카피레프트가 적합.
III. 추가정보
| 구분 | 내용 | 시사점 |
|---|---|---|
| 법적 리스크 | 조건 미이행 시 분쟁·컴플라이언스 이슈 | 라이선스 검토·SBOM 관리 필수 |
| 혼합 전략 | 듀얼 라이선스(OSS+상용) | 상업화와 공유 균형 |
| 시험 포인트 | “자유 활용 vs 자유 공유” 구분 | 정의·의무·전염성 키워드 |
요약: 허용적=실용, 카피레프트=공유 의무. 조직 목적에 맞춰 선택.
한 줄 복습
- 허용적: 제약 최소·상용 우호
- 카피레프트: 동일조건·전염성
- 선택기준: 배포·컴플라이언스
728x90
반응형
'공부 > 정보관리기술사' 카테고리의 다른 글
| [정보관리기술사] ISO 25000 (SQuRE) 소프트웨어 품질 평가 표준 정리 (0) | 2025.09.19 |
|---|---|
| [정보관리기술사] ISO 29119 소프트웨어 테스트 표준 (0) | 2025.09.19 |
| [정보관리기술사] 아키텍처 스타일 vs 디자인패턴 비교 (0) | 2025.09.17 |
| [정보관리기술사] 모놀리식 아키텍처 vs 마이크로서비스 아키텍처 비교 (0) | 2025.09.14 |
| [정보관리기술사] 요구공학: 요구사항 개발과 요구사항 관리 정리 (0) | 2025.09.14 |